Part A Albert Trading Limited used the statement of financial position approach to estimate the impairment loss of receivable. An aging of account receivable at 31 December 2019 revealed that $68,000 of the $835,000 outstanding accounts receivable will prove uncollectible. The Allowance for Impairment has a debit balance of $6,200 prior to adjustment. Required: (Explanation of the Journal Entry is not required) Prepare an adjusting entry on 31 December 2019 to recognize the impairment loss of receivable. Part B On 12 January 2020, Peter Lee, a major customer, declared bankruptcy, and Albert Trading, determined that a receivable from Peter Lee in the amount of S3,400 was worthless. Required: (Explanation of the Journal Entry is not required) Prepare the journal entry required by Albert Trading in this situation.
